随着业务的扩展和技术的迭代,服务器架构的复杂性和多样性也随之增加
面对多个软件服务器地址的管理挑战,如何构建一个高效、稳定且易于维护的服务器架构,成为了众多企业IT部门亟需解决的问题
本文将深入探讨如何优化服务器架构,以有效管理多个软件服务器地址,旨在为企业提供一套可行的解决方案
一、引言 服务器作为IT系统的核心组成部分,承载着数据存储、应用处理、网络通信等多重任务
随着云计算、大数据、物联网等技术的迅猛发展,企业往往需要部署多个软件服务器来满足不同业务场景的需求
然而,多个软件服务器地址的管理却带来了诸多挑战,如地址分配混乱、访问效率低下、安全风险增加等
因此,优化服务器架构,实现多个软件服务器地址的高效管理,对于提升企业IT系统的稳定性和效率至关重要
二、多个软件服务器地址管理的挑战 2.1 地址分配混乱 在缺乏统一规划和管理的情况下,多个软件服务器地址的分配往往变得混乱无序
这不仅增加了IT人员的管理难度,还可能导致地址冲突、访问失败等问题
此外,混乱的地址分配还可能影响网络性能和安全性
2.2 访问效率低下 多个软件服务器地址的存在使得客户端在访问服务时需要经过复杂的路由选择和地址解析过程
这不仅增加了访问延迟,还可能影响用户体验和业务连续性
特别是在高并发场景下,访问效率低下的问题尤为突出
2.3 安全风险增加 多个软件服务器地址的暴露增加了系统的安全风险
攻击者可能利用地址扫描、端口扫描等手段发现系统的薄弱环节,进而发动攻击
此外,不安全的地址分配和管理还可能导致数据泄露、服务中断等严重后果
三、优化服务器架构的策略与实践 3.1 统一地址管理 为了实现多个软件服务器地址的高效管理,首先需要建立一套统一的地址管理机制
这包括制定明确的地址分配策略、建立地址数据库、实现地址的动态分配和回收等
通过统一地址管理,可以确保地址的唯一性、准确性和可追溯性,降低管理难度和风险
在具体实践中,企业可以采用DNS(域名系统)或DHCP(动态主机配置协议)等技术来实现地址的统一管理
DNS可以将易于记忆的域名映射到复杂的IP地址上,方便用户访问;而DHCP则可以自动为客户端分配IP地址和其他网络配置信息,减轻IT人员的管理负担
3.2 负载均衡与流量调度 负载均衡是优化服务器架构、提高访问效率的重要手段
通过负载均衡技术,可以将客户端的请求均匀分配到多个服务器上,避免单个服务器过载导致的性能瓶颈
同时,负载均衡还可以实现故障的自动切换和恢复,提高系统的可用性和稳定性
在多个软件服务器地址的场景下,负载均衡技术可以进一步升级为流量调度
流量调度不仅可以根据服务器的负载情况分配请求,还可以根据地理位置、用户行为等因素进行智能调度,实现更精细化的流量管理
这不仅可以提高访问效率,还可以优化用户体验和业务连续性
3.3 安全防护与隔离 面对多个软件服务器地址带来的安全风险,企业需要加强安全防护和隔离措施
这包括部署防火墙、入侵检测系统、安全审计系统等安全设备,以及采用虚拟局域网(VLAN)、网络地址转换(NAT)等技术实现网络隔离和访问控制
此外,企业还需要定期对服务器进行安全漏洞扫描和修复工作,确保系统的安全性和稳定性
同时,建立应急响应机制和安全事件处置流程也是必不可少的
在发生安全事件时,能够迅速定位问题、采取措施并恢复服务,将损失降到最低
3.4 自动化与智能化管理 随着自动化和智能化技术的不断发展,企业可以将其应用于服务器架构的优化和管理中
通过自动化工具和技术,可以实现服务器配置的快速部署、监控和故障排查等功能,提高管理效率和准确性
同时,智能化技术还可以根据历史数据和实时信息预测系统状态、优化资源配置并提前预警潜在问题
在具体实践中,企业可以采用Ansible、Puppet等自动化配置管理工具来实现服务器的快速部署和配置;采用Prometheus、Grafana等监控工具来实时监控服务器的性能和状态;采用机器学习算法对系统日志进行分析和预测,发现潜在的安全风险和性能瓶颈
四、案例分析 案例一:某电商企业的服务器架构优化实践 某电商企业面临着多个软件服务器地址管理混乱、访问效率低下等问题
为了优化服务器架构,该企业采取了以下措施: 1.统一地址管理:采用DNS和DHCP技术实现地址的统一分配和管理,确保地址的唯一性和准确性
2.负载均衡与流量调度:部署F5负载均衡器,根据服务器的负载情况和地理位置进行智能调度,提高访问效率和用户体验
3.安全防护与隔离:部署防火墙、入侵检测系统等安全设备,并采用VLAN技术实现网络隔离和访问控制
同时,定期对服务器进行安全漏洞扫描和修复工作
4.自动化与智能化管理:采用Ansible自动化配置管理工具实现服务器的快速部署和配置;采用Prometheus监控工具实时监控服务器的性能和状态;采用机器学习算法对系统日志进行分析和预测
经过优化后,该企业的服务器架构变得更加高效、稳定和易于维护
访问延迟降低了30%以上,用户满意度得到了显著提升
同时,系统的安全性和稳定性也得到了有效保障
案例二:某金融企业的多活数据中心建设实践 某金融企业为了提升业务连续性和容灾能力,决定建设多活数据中心
在多活数据中心的场景下,多个软件服务器地址的管理变得更加复杂
为了应对这一挑战,该企业采取了以下措施: 1.统一地址规划与分配:在制定多活数据中心建设方案时,就充分考虑了地址规划和分配的问题
采用DNS和DHCP技术实现地址的统一规划和分配,确保地址的唯一性和准确性
同时,建立了地址数据库和地址回收机制,实现地址的动态管理
2.智能流量调度与负载均衡:在多活数据中心的场景下,智能流量调度和负载均衡是实现业务连续性和容灾能力的关键
该企业采用了先进的流量调度算法和负载均衡技术,根据服务器的负载情况、地理位置等因素进行智能调度和负载均衡
同时,建立了故障切换和恢复机制,确保在单个数据中心发生故障时能够迅速切换到其他数据中心并恢复服务
3.安全防护与隔离:在多活数据中心的场景下,安全防护和隔离措施更加重要
该企业部署了防火墙、入侵检测系统等安全设备,并采用VLAN、NAT等技术实现网络隔离和访问控制
同时,建立了安全事件处置流程和应急响应机制,确保在发生安全事件时能够迅速定位问题、采取措施并恢复服务
4.自动化与智能化运维:为了降低运维成本和提高运维效率,该企业采用了自动化和智能化运维技术
通过Ansible等自动化配置管理工具实现服务器的快速部署和配置;通过Prometheus等监控工具实时监控服务器的性能和状态;通过机器学习算法对系统日志进行分析和预测,发现潜在的安全风险和性能瓶颈
同时,建立了运维知识库和自动化运维流程,提高运维人员的工作效率和准确性
经过多活数据中心的建设和优化后,该企业的业务连续性和容灾能力得到了显著提升
即使在单个数据中心发生故障的情况下,也能够迅速切换到其他数据中心并恢复服务,确保业务的连续性和稳定性
同时,运维成本也得到了有效降低,运维效率得到了显著提升
五、结论与展望 优化服务器架构、高效管理多个软件服务器地址是企业提升IT系统稳定性和效率的重要手段
通过统一地址管理、负载均衡与流量调度、安全防护与隔离以及自动化与智能化管理等策略和实践,企业可以构建一个高效、稳定且易于维护的服务器架构
未来,随着技术的不断发展和业务的不断拓展,企业还需要持续关注服务器架构的优化和管理问题,不断探索新的技术和方法来应对新的挑战和机遇
同时,加强与其他企业和组织的交流与合作也是必不可少的
通过共享经验、互相学习借鉴,可以共同推动服务器架构优化和管理领域的发展和创新